About Conference


The International Conference on Languages and Communication (ICLC 2024) is a conference organised by the Faculty of Languages and Communication, Universiti Sultan Zainal Abidin (UniSZA).

ICLC 2024 aims to provide a platform for academicians, educators, language practitioners, industry professionals, teachers, teacher trainers, students and other like-minded individuals from the fields of language to exchange and share their experiences, new ideas, and research results on all aspects of language teaching, learning and research. The conference will be an opportunity for participants to meet and share their experiences and research results as well as discuss practical challenges encountered and solutions adopted.

Thus, ICLC 2024 welcomes submissions as paper presentations on the conference theme: “Navigating Changes of Language and Communication in the 21st Century.”

ALL accepted papers will be published in conference proceedings with e-ISBN.  The proceedings are based on the theme of the conference, which is Navigating Changes in Language and Communication in the 21st Century.  In this era, marked by significant technological advancements, globalisation, and cultural shifts, hence the ways societies communicate have undergone profound transformation across diverse linguistic and media landscape.  Innovations such as social media platforms and artificial intelligence play pivotal roles in facilitating improved communication and advancing civilisation. Ultimately, this theme encourages the world to reflect on the power of language and communication to bridge divides and foster connection in an increasingly interconnected world. By navigating these changes, a more progressive, vibrant and tolerable global society is created.
